site stats

Trigger excel macro using python

WebFeb 23, 2024 · To run the macro, deploy the Run Excel macro action and populate its name in the Macro field. To find the name of a macro, open the respective workbook and … WebSorted by: 1. Yes you can create an Excel macro with another Excel macro. For that to work, you need to tell Excel to Trust Access to the VBA Project Object model. (The setting is …

VBA for smarties: Excel & Python

WebMay 22, 2024 · Photo by Jasmine Huang on Unsplash. In Automate Excel with Python, the concepts of the Excel Object Model which contain Objects, Properties, Methods and Events are shared.The tricks to access the Objects, Properties, and Methods in Excel with Python pywin32 library are also explained with examples.. Now, let us leverage the automation of … chem 18 test https://boxh.net

VBA for smarties: Excel & Python

WebMay 20, 2024 · I, however, was missing the Google Apps Script experience in Python, i.e., I wanted to develop interactive spreadsheet apps directly in Google Sheets. So I went ahead and added Google Sheets support to xlwings: instead of using the Sheets API to talk from Python to Google Sheets, xlwings goes the other way around and talks from Google … WebJan 20, 2024 · Look for a Python Script in the same location as the spreadsheet; Look for a Python Script with the same name as the spreadsheet (but with a .py extension) From the Python Script, call the function “main()” Without any further ado, let us look at a few examples of how this can be used. Example 1: Operate Outside of Excel, and return the … WebMar 1, 2024 · How to Import and Export Data with Python. This task involves using Python libraries such as Pandas to read Excel files into a DataFrame object. You can then manipulate it and analyze it using Python. You can … chem 178 barge strappings

Win32 python and excel macros - Python

Category:How to Run Excel VBA Macro From Python - Python In Office

Tags:Trigger excel macro using python

Trigger excel macro using python

Running an Excel Macro with Python - Coding - PsychoPy

WebSep 19, 2024 · Running Excel Macro from Python. To Run a Excel Marcro from python, You don't need almost nothing. Below a script that does the job. The advantage of Updating data from a macro inside Excel is that you immediatly see the result. You don't have to save or … WebJan 24, 2024 · Because of this most of the legacy automation was done using excel macros. ... As a developer, I would suggest of using the macros to trigger it from python and write …

Trigger excel macro using python

Did you know?

WebThe VBA code to trigger Python is in the codemodule of Sheet1. The Python code illustrates 2 methods to pass a SQL-string in Python: 1. the SQL-string is 'hard coded' in the Python code: the function 'list'. 2. the SQL-string is passed as argument from Excel to the Python code: the function 'combo'. import sqlite3. WebOct 23, 2024 · So I would like to generalize it to seek a way to run Excel VBA macros in linux environment. What are the actual . Stack Exchange Network.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, ... Ideally this is a python-specific question but my findings so far are negative.

WebRunning a Python script using Excel macros. Create a simple Python script. Click File > Options > Customize Ribbon > select the Developer check box. Figure 2:Add VBA script. … WebThis video will show how to execute an Excel VBA macro from Python using the xlwings library. 𝗦𝗢𝗨𝗥𝗖𝗘 𝗖𝗢𝗗𝗘:import xlwings as xw# -- OPEN WORKBOOKwb...

WebAug 20, 2024 · The Excel events are described in Microsoft's Excel Object Model documentation. To subscribe to COM events in Python we use the win32com.client.DispatchWithEvents function. This takes a COM object and a Python class that implements the event handlers for that object. For example: from win32com.client … WebAug 2, 2024 · Step One: Import our Libraries & Reference the Excel Application. The first thing we need to do is import our library that will allow to plugin to the Windows’ API. Here is the code: import ...

WebMacro functions can call back into Excel using the Excel COM API (which is identical to the VBA Excel object model). The function xl_app can be used to get the Excel.Application …

http://www.snb-vba.eu/VBA_Python_en.html flicker the horsehttp://www.snb-vba.eu/VBA_Python_en.html flicker tips and tricks robloxWebMay 1, 2024 · The official dedicated python forum. try import win32com.client as win32 excel = win32.Dispatch("Excel.Application") # create an instance of Excel book = excel.Workbooks.Open(Filename=r'C:\Users\workbook1.xlsm') excel.Application.Run('workbook1.xlsm!Grey Scaling.OpenWorkbook') # This runs the … chem 17 testWebNov 3, 2024 · Feel free to use your own file, although the output from your own file won’t match the sample output in this book. The next step is to write some code to open the spreadsheet. To do that, create a new file named open_workbook.py and add this code to it: # open_workbook.py. from openpyxl import load_workbook. flicker thesaurusWebOct 18, 2006 · (experiment with using "" instead of " since VBA requires embedded " to be escaped by "" - but since you are writing this in Python it might not be necessary). Maybe experiment with writing a VBA macro in Excel which can successfuly launch the macro you need and then translate the appropriate snippet to your python script. Also - are you sure ... flicker tori amos lyricsWebThe following code was taken from a StackOverflow post, so I'm admittedly not familiar with everything going on here. The code runs, but I have a couple questions. import win32com.client xl=win32com.client.Dispatch ('Excel.Application') xl.Workbooks.Open (Filename=r'C:\Path\File.xlsm', ReadOnly=1) xl.Application.Run ('Macro_Name') xl ... flicker thumbnailWebIn this tutorial, I will show you, how to execute a Python script from Excel by using VBA. ... To run a python script in VBA is very easy and I will explain every step. Resources: … flicker threshold